Seeking a balance
Much like how natural wildfires can reset the ecosystem, fiery football practices also can provide useful sparks during a five-week-long spring training.
In the first nine spring practices, the UH coaches have tried to find a balance between promotion and provocation; being chipper and chirping.
That was evident in a scuffle during the past Saturday’s scrimmage. While fights, particularly the hold-me-back type, can be a boost to lackadaisical practices, Saturday’s scuffle rankled the coaches because it came during a red-zone drill designed to simulate a game situation. A player, who was trying to serve as peacekeeper, was nicked on the helmet by a swung helmet.
The coaches are willing to write off penalties such as false starts and offsides, as part of the business of football. But personal fouls and unsportsmanlike penalties are unpardonable. It has been a goal to cut back on emotional penalties this spring.
Last year, the Warriors were flagged 19 times for personal fouls or unsportsmanlike penalties. That does not include two other violations that were waived because of off-setting penalties.
Coach Nick Rolovich said he wanted his team to be “more mentally strong when things got tough” during Saturday’s practice.”
He added: “People are worrying about the wrong things. โฆ Until we change that, we’re a three-win football team that doesn’t focus on the right things.”
